Francesca Granato

Head Of Product Design at ClearScore

Francesca Granato has a diverse work experience spanning multiple roles and industries. Francesca is currently the Head of Product Design at ClearScore, a position they assumed in July 2022. Prior to that, they worked as a Principal Product Designer at the same company from October 2021 to July 2022.

Before joining ClearScore, Francesca worked at Rightpoint, where they held the role of Associate Design Director from November 2020 to October 2021, and before that, they served as the Principal UX Architect from October 2018 to November 2020.

Francesca also has experience at Canonical Ltd., where they worked as the Lead User Experience Designer from September 2016 to October 2018, and as a Senior User Experience Designer from September 2014 to September 2016. During their tenure, they were responsible for managing a team and overseeing UX/UI updates to Ubuntu websites.

Additionally, Francesca worked at Unboxed Consulting as a Product Designer from September 2013 to September 2014, focusing on visual design, user experience design, and UX research. Francesca also practiced Lean UX techniques and collaborated with developers in an Agile environment.

Earlier in their career, Francesca held positions at Applied Wayfinding as Lead Digital Designer from June 2011 to June 2013, at ESA (European Space Agency) as a Contract Designer from December 2006 to May 2007, at Unreal Studio as a Graphic Designer from February 2005 to December 2006, at STUDIO MYERSCOUGH LIMITED as a Junior Designer from December 2004 to February 2005, and at FABRICA (Benetton) as a Graphic Designer from September 2003 to December 2004.

Throughout their career, Francesca has gained expertise in various aspects of design, including product design, web design, visual design, user experience design, information architecture, and art direction. Francesca has also worked with notable clients such as Heathrow BAA, Mulberry, Transport for London, and Benetton.

Francesca Granato received a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) degree in Graphic Design from the University of Brighton, where they studied from 2000 to 2003.
